What it detects

This rule detects creation of a Debugger or MonitorProcess value under Image File Execution Options, an IFEO hijack the Wazuh-agent miner campaign uses for persistence and to launch its payload when a targeted process starts. IFEO debugger entries are seldom set legitimately and are a well-known persistence and injection vector.
